Liberation Day (Dutch: Bevrijdingsdag) is a public holiday in the Netherlands to mark the end of the German occupation of the country during the Second World War. It follows the Remembrance of the Dead (Dodenherdenking) on 4 May. Web16 feb. 2024 · May is a significant month in the Dutch calendar. Only a week after the nation celebrates King’s Day ( Koningsdag ), it turns its attention to the past; more specifically, the end of Nazi Germany’s occupation during WWII.
